Intel to launch desktop platform in Q3 2005

Posted on Wednesday, February 09 2005 @ 13:04 CET by Thomas De Maesschalck
Intel has confirmed plans to launch a Centrino-like platform for desktop computers, it is planned for launch in Q3 of this year.
Intel marketing director Jeff Tripaldi didn't provide much more information: the name has yet to be chosen, he said, and it will centre, as anticipated, on the company's dual-core desktop chip 'Smithfield', although Tripaldi didn't mention that codename.
